Output d3c4938294b13a02c9615aac43e9b6c7c47225c23d47ff6458c66a29359d9ef0:7

value
88292508
script pubkey
OP_0 OP_PUSHBYTES_32 243d6503d8f60d7ffddf347e1b6ff39ceb7c3dc46e2c0047ee26d2639f16bc78
address
bc1qys7k2q7c7cxhllwlx3lpkmlnnn4hc0wydckqq3lwymfx88ckh3uqna60k2
transaction
d3c4938294b13a02c9615aac43e9b6c7c47225c23d47ff6458c66a29359d9ef0
spent
true